Since the genome sequencing of rice, as the first crop plant, in 2002, the genomes of about one dozen oilseed crops have been sequenced and more are to follow. This has made it possible to decipher the exact nucleotide sequence and chromosomal positions of agroeconomic genes. Most importantly, comparative genomics and genotyping-by-sequencing have opened up new vistas for exploring available biodiversity, particularly of wild crop relatives, for identifying useful donor genes.. | 出版日期 | Book 2019 | 关键词 | global warming; adaptation; climate-smart genes; abiotic stress; genomics-assisted breeding; molecular br | 版次 | 1 | doi | https://doi.org/10.1007/978-3-319-93536-2 | isbn_ebook | 978-3-319-93536-2 | copyright | Springer Nature Switzerland AG 2019 |
